Home
last modified time | relevance | path

Searched refs:bcm (Results 1 – 25 of 103) sorted by relevance

12345

/OK3568_Linux_fs/kernel/drivers/interconnect/qcom/
H A Dbcm-voter.c68 static void bcm_aggregate(struct qcom_icc_bcm *bcm) in bcm_aggregate() argument
77 for (i = 0; i < bcm->num_nodes; i++) { in bcm_aggregate()
78 node = bcm->nodes[i]; in bcm_aggregate()
79 temp = bcm_div(node->sum_avg[bucket] * bcm->aux_data.width, in bcm_aggregate()
83 temp = bcm_div(node->max_peak[bucket] * bcm->aux_data.width, in bcm_aggregate()
88 temp = agg_avg[bucket] * bcm->vote_scale; in bcm_aggregate()
89 bcm->vote_x[bucket] = bcm_div(temp, bcm->aux_data.unit); in bcm_aggregate()
91 temp = agg_peak[bucket] * bcm->vote_scale; in bcm_aggregate()
92 bcm->vote_y[bucket] = bcm_div(temp, bcm->aux_data.unit); in bcm_aggregate()
95 if (bcm->keepalive && bcm->vote_x[QCOM_ICC_BUCKET_AMC] == 0 && in bcm_aggregate()
[all …]
H A Dicc-rpmh.c134 int qcom_icc_bcm_init(struct qcom_icc_bcm *bcm, struct device *dev) in qcom_icc_bcm_init() argument
142 if (bcm->addr) in qcom_icc_bcm_init()
145 bcm->addr = cmd_db_read_addr(bcm->name); in qcom_icc_bcm_init()
146 if (!bcm->addr) { in qcom_icc_bcm_init()
148 bcm->name); in qcom_icc_bcm_init()
152 data = cmd_db_read_aux_data(bcm->name, &data_count); in qcom_icc_bcm_init()
155 bcm->name, PTR_ERR(data)); in qcom_icc_bcm_init()
160 bcm->name); in qcom_icc_bcm_init()
164 bcm->aux_data.unit = le32_to_cpu(data->unit); in qcom_icc_bcm_init()
165 bcm->aux_data.width = le16_to_cpu(data->width); in qcom_icc_bcm_init()
[all …]
H A DMakefile3 icc-bcm-voter-objs := bcm-voter.o
15 obj-$(CONFIG_INTERCONNECT_QCOM_BCM_VOTER) += icc-bcm-voter.o
H A Dbcm-voter.h24 void qcom_icc_bcm_voter_add(struct bcm_voter *voter, struct qcom_icc_bcm *bcm);
/OK3568_Linux_fs/kernel/drivers/bluetooth/
H A Dhci_bcm.c312 static int bcm_request_irq(struct bcm_data *bcm) in bcm_request_irq() argument
314 struct bcm_device *bdev = bcm->dev; in bcm_request_irq()
371 struct bcm_data *bcm = hu->priv; in bcm_setup_sleep() local
375 sleep_params.host_wake_active = !bcm->dev->irq_active_low; in bcm_setup_sleep()
391 static inline int bcm_request_irq(struct bcm_data *bcm) { return 0; } in bcm_request_irq() argument
398 struct bcm_data *bcm = hu->priv; in bcm_set_diag() local
412 skb_queue_tail(&bcm->txq, skb); in bcm_set_diag()
420 struct bcm_data *bcm; in bcm_open() local
429 bcm = kzalloc(sizeof(*bcm), GFP_KERNEL); in bcm_open()
430 if (!bcm) in bcm_open()
[all …]
/OK3568_Linux_fs/kernel/drivers/phy/broadcom/
H A DMakefile3 obj-$(CONFIG_PHY_CYGNUS_PCIE) += phy-bcm-cygnus-pcie.o
4 obj-$(CONFIG_BCM_KONA_USB2_PHY) += phy-bcm-kona-usb2.o
5 obj-$(CONFIG_PHY_BCM_NS_USB2) += phy-bcm-ns-usb2.o
6 obj-$(CONFIG_PHY_BCM_NS_USB3) += phy-bcm-ns-usb3.o
7 obj-$(CONFIG_PHY_NS2_PCIE) += phy-bcm-ns2-pcie.o
8 obj-$(CONFIG_PHY_NS2_USB_DRD) += phy-bcm-ns2-usbdrd.o
14 obj-$(CONFIG_PHY_BCM_SR_PCIE) += phy-bcm-sr-pcie.o
15 obj-$(CONFIG_PHY_BCM_SR_USB) += phy-bcm-sr-usb.o
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/spi/
H A Dbrcm,spi-bcm-qspi.txt26 "brcm,spi-brcmstb-qspi", "brcm,spi-bcm-qspi" : MSPI+BSPI on BRCMSTB SoCs
27 "brcm,spi-brcmstb-mspi", "brcm,spi-bcm-qspi" : Second Instance of MSPI
29 "brcm,spi-bcm7425-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
31 "brcm,spi-bcm7429-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
33 "brcm,spi-bcm7435-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
35 "brcm,spi-bcm7445-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
37 "brcm,spi-bcm7216-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
39 "brcm,spi-bcm7278-qspi", "brcm,spi-bcm-qspi", "brcm,spi-brcmstb-mspi" : Second Instance of MSPI
41 "brcm,spi-nsp-qspi", "brcm,spi-bcm-qspi" : MSPI+BSPI on Cygnus, NSP
42 "brcm,spi-ns2-qspi", "brcm,spi-bcm-qspi" : NS2 SoCs
[all …]
/OK3568_Linux_fs/kernel/net/can/
H A DMakefile13 obj-$(CONFIG_CAN_BCM) += can-bcm.o
14 can-bcm-y := bcm.o
/OK3568_Linux_fs/kernel/drivers/net/mdio/
H A DMakefile7 obj-$(CONFIG_MDIO_BCM_IPROC) += mdio-bcm-iproc.o
8 obj-$(CONFIG_MDIO_BCM_UNIMAC) += mdio-bcm-unimac.o
25 obj-$(CONFIG_MDIO_BUS_MUX_BCM_IPROC) += mdio-mux-bcm-iproc.o
/OK3568_Linux_fs/kernel/drivers/nvmem/
H A DMakefile10 obj-$(CONFIG_NVMEM_BCM_OCOTP) += nvmem-bcm-ocotp.o
11 nvmem-bcm-ocotp-y := bcm-ocotp.o
/OK3568_Linux_fs/kernel/drivers/net/dsa/
H A DMakefile2 obj-$(CONFIG_NET_DSA_BCM_SF2) += bcm-sf2.o
3 bcm-sf2-objs := bcm_sf2.o bcm_sf2_cfp.o
/OK3568_Linux_fs/kernel/drivers/mailbox/
H A DMakefile38 obj-$(CONFIG_BCM_PDC_MBOX) += bcm-pdc-mailbox.o
40 obj-$(CONFIG_BCM_FLEXRM_MBOX) += bcm-flexrm-mailbox.o
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/mailbox/
H A Dbrcm,iproc-pdc-mbox.txt15 - brcm,use-bcm-hdr: present if a BCM header precedes each frame.
24 brcm,use-bcm-hdr;
/OK3568_Linux_fs/kernel/drivers/soc/bcm/
H A DKconfig45 source "drivers/soc/bcm/bcm63xx/Kconfig"
46 source "drivers/soc/bcm/brcmstb/Kconfig"
/OK3568_Linux_fs/yocto/poky/meta/recipes-extended/blktool/blktool/
H A D0003-Fix-3-d-argument-for-BLKROSET-it-must-be-const-int.patch40 do_32 = parse_bool(argc, argv, bcm);
44 + if (bcm->arg_type == bc_arg_int_ptr) {
/OK3568_Linux_fs/yocto/meta-openembedded/meta-multimedia/recipes-multimedia/vlc/vlc/
H A D0004-Use-packageconfig-to-detect-mmal-support.patch35 - [ AC_MSG_ERROR([Cannot find bcm library...]) ],
36 - [ AC_MSG_WARN([Cannot find bcm library...]) ])
/OK3568_Linux_fs/kernel/arch/arm/boot/dts/
H A Dbcm-nsp.dtsi35 #include <dt-bindings/clock/bcm-nsp.h>
67 enable-method = "brcm,bcm-nsp-smp";
268 brcm,use-bcm-hdr;
287 compatible = "brcm,spi-nsp-qspi", "brcm,spi-bcm-qspi";
366 compatible = "brcm,bcm-nsp-rng";
497 compatible = "brcm,bcm-nsp-ahci";
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/arm/bcm/
H A Dbrcm,brcmstb.txt7 - compatible: "brcm,bcm<chip_id>", "brcm,brcmstb"
19 - compatible: "brcm,bcm<chip_id>-sun-top-ctrl", "syscon"
20 - compatible: "brcm,bcm<chip_id>-cpu-biu-ctrl",
23 - compatible: "brcm,bcm<chip_id>-hif-continuation", "syscon"
/OK3568_Linux_fs/kernel/drivers/pwm/
H A DMakefile8 obj-$(CONFIG_PWM_BCM_IPROC) += pwm-bcm-iproc.o
9 obj-$(CONFIG_PWM_BCM_KONA) += pwm-bcm-kona.o
/OK3568_Linux_fs/u-boot/drivers/net/
H A DMakefile13 obj-$(CONFIG_BCM_SF2_ETH) += bcm-sf2-eth.o
14 obj-$(CONFIG_BCM_SF2_ETH_GMAC) += bcm-sf2-eth-gmac.o
/OK3568_Linux_fs/kernel/drivers/net/phy/
H A DMakefile47 obj-$(CONFIG_BCM_CYGNUS_PHY) += bcm-cygnus.o
48 obj-$(CONFIG_BCM_NET_PHYLIB) += bcm-phy-lib.o
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/clock/
H A Dbrcm,iproc-clocks.txt99 "include/dt-bindings/clock/bcm-cygnus.h"
163 "include/dt-bindings/clock/bcm-nsp.h"
194 "include/dt-bindings/clock/bcm-ns2.h"
255 "include/dt-bindings/clock/bcm-sr.h"
/OK3568_Linux_fs/kernel/arch/arm64/boot/dts/qcom/
H A Dsm8150.dtsi448 qcom,bcm-voters = <&apps_bcm_voter>;
455 qcom,bcm-voters = <&apps_bcm_voter>;
462 qcom,bcm-voters = <&apps_bcm_voter>;
469 qcom,bcm-voters = <&apps_bcm_voter>;
476 qcom,bcm-voters = <&apps_bcm_voter>;
483 qcom,bcm-voters = <&apps_bcm_voter>;
490 qcom,bcm-voters = <&apps_bcm_voter>;
565 qcom,bcm-voters = <&apps_bcm_voter>;
878 qcom,bcm-voters = <&apps_bcm_voter>;
885 qcom,bcm-voters = <&apps_bcm_voter>;
[all …]
/OK3568_Linux_fs/kernel/arch/arm64/boot/dts/broadcom/northstar2/
H A Dns2.dtsi36 #include <dt-bindings/clock/bcm-ns2.h>
222 brcm,use-bcm-hdr;
238 brcm,use-bcm-hdr;
254 brcm,use-bcm-hdr;
270 brcm,use-bcm-hdr;
748 compatible = "brcm,spi-ns2-qspi", "brcm,spi-bcm-qspi";
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/misc/
H A Dbrcm,kona-smc.txt8 - DEPRECATED: compatible : "bcm,kona-smc"

12345